Complex product manufacturing industry is a pillar industry in the country, with therise of informatization of manufacturing industry, many kinds of computer applicationsystems and management information systems are applied to the production andmanagement activities, gradually realizes "rejection drawings ", preliminary planning toguide the production, the local computer integrated manufacturing objectives, brought hugebenefits to the enterprise, especially the improvement of production efficiency. However,with the establishment of the information system more and more, the amount of stored datain exponential growth, existing semantic heterogeneity and structure of heterogeneitybetween each subsystem.Causing the data sharing is poor, and the system to the newlyestablished again carries on the structural design, data storage torepeat informa-tion, enterprises to bring great pressure data storage. At the same time, most of the complexproduct manufacturing enterprises are the project manufacturing enterprises, the mainreason that they are difficult to shift from scheduling model for planning control type is lackof effective project work breakdown, while effective project work breakdown based oncomprehensive management on the information of management elements, therefore, how tointegrate the management elements on the managed object standardize and collaborativebecome the key to solve such problem of enterprise. This paper in view of the abovequestion, proposed management elements of metadata extraction algorithm for complexproduct manufacturing enterprises, using the integrated management of metadata to solvedata integrated management, and finally establish management elements database, buildinga foundation for the subsequent integration and modeling based on the managementelements metadata.Based on the study of metadata and element modeling tools, a detailed analysis wascarried out firstly that the characteristic of complex product manufacturing enterpriseproduction and data management, aiming at the characteristics of the storage environmentthe main data source for the relational database, firstly extact the structure of metadataaccording to the relational database modeling, according to the information needs of theintegrated management elements establish management element information integrationmodel according to the MOF (Meta Object Facility), the elements of managementinformation feedback to the object description information(object metadata) through themodel of top-down, based on CWM (Common Warehouse Metamodel) standards to establish CWM standard management elements metadata, which can meet the application ofevery platform and integration needs, forming a bottom-up structure extraction, top-downmanagement elements of information cover strategy. Finally, in order to extract and managemanagement elements metadata conveniently, using relational database to storagemanagement elements metadata, using object relation mapping model to storage modeCWM-based object-management elements metadata to a relational database, established themanagement element element database.In order to test the work of this paper, this paper ends with a gearbox factorywarehouse management system as an example for empirical research, respectively from theextraction based on the structure of the database metadata, the reflection of the informationmanagement elements, based on the CWM standard management metadata standardizationand management elements of metadata management have carried on the example.
